2024-12-11 23:46:50
《vue实现
pdf在线预览》
在vue项目中实现pdf在线预览并不复杂。首先,可利用pdf.js库,它是一个专门用于在网页上处理pdf的javascript库。
安装pdf.js后,在vue组件中,通过import引入相关模块。然后,创建一个容器元素,例如`
`。使用javascript代码获取这个容器,再借助pdf.js的api加载pdf文件。通过`pdfjs.getdocument('pdf文件路径')`获取文档对象,接着以`doc.getpage(pagenumber)`获取指定页面,将页面渲染到之前创建的容器中。这样,就可以在vue应用中实现pdf的在线预览,为用户提供便捷的文档查看体验。
vue pdf在线查看
# vue中实现pdf在线查看
在vue项目里实现pdf在线查看功能很实用。
首先,需要安装相关插件,如pdfjs - viewer。安装完成后,在vue组件中引入该插件。
在组件的模板部分,可以创建一个容器元素来承载pdf显示。在脚本部分,通过调用pdfjs - viewer的相关方法来加载pdf文件。例如,可以从服务器获取pdf文件的路径,然后将其传递给查看器进行渲染。
这样,用户在浏览器端就能方便地在线查看pdf文档,无需下载。这一功能在文档管理系统、电子书籍阅读等场景下非常有用,提升了用户体验,也增强了vue应用的功能多样性。
vue在线预览doc文件
# vue实现doc文件在线预览
在vue项目中实现在线预览doc文件,可以借助一些插件或转换服务。
一种常见的方法是将doc文件转换为html格式再进行预览。可以利用后端服务,例如一些办公文档转换的api,先把doc文件转换为html。
在vue组件中,使用`